The return of distance
Names like Pre, Salazar and McChesney helped lead the University of Oregon distance runner boom of the 1970's and 80's. But as Bill Bowerman and Bill Dellinger retired, distance running faded out. Now it is back. In KVAL's latest installment of Track Town Revival, Nick Krupke says Olympian Galen Rupp has lead the charge in the re-birth of the distance corps.
